What are the classifications of condenser?

What are the classifications of condenser?

The major types of condensers used are (1) water-cooled, (2) air-cooled, and (3) evaporative. In evaporative condensers, both air and water are used. Three common types of water-cooled condensers are (1) double pipe, (2) shell and tube (as shown in Fig. 6.9), and (3) shell and coil.

What are the classifications of a steam condenser?

The steam condensers are broadly classified into two types:

  • Surface condensers (or non-mixing type condensers). In surface condensers, there is no direct contact between the exhaust steam and the cooling water.
  • Jet condensers (or mixing type condensers).

What are the two types of air cooled condensers?

Air cooled condensers are of two types: natural convection and forced convection. In the natural convection type, the air flows over it in natural a way depending upon the temperature of the condenser coil. In the forced air type, a fan operated by a motor blows air over the condenser coil.

What is the principle of condenser?

The purpose of the condenser is to receive the high-pressure gas from the compressor and convert this gas to a liquid. It does it by heat transfer, or the principle that heat will always move from a warmer to a cooler substance.

How do I choose a condenser?

The principal factors involved in selecting a suitable type of condenser depends on whether condensation is total or partial, whether the vapors are single or multicomponent, and whether some components are noncondensable. The coolant can impose further restrictions, particularly if it vaporizes.

What is the function of steam condenser?

A surface condenser or steam condenser is a water-cooled shell and tube heat exchanger used to condensate the exhaust steam from the steam turbine in thermal power stations: the steam is converted from gaseous to liquid state at a pressure level below atmospheric pressure.

What are the advantages of condenser?

Advantages of a condenser in a steam power plant It increases the efficiency of the power plant due to increased enthalpy drop. It reduces back pressure of the steam which results in more work output. It reduces temperature of the exhaust steam which also results in more work output.

What is the function of condenser in microscope?

Condenser Aperture Diaphragm Function On upright microscopes, the condenser is located beneath the stage and serves to gather wavefronts from the microscope light source and concentrate them into a cone of light that illuminates the specimen with uniform intensity over the entire viewfield.

Which is the last type of condenser to work?

And finally, the last one of the types of condensers is the evaporative one. it is actually the mix of an air-cooled and water-cooled condenser. Evaporative condensers use air and water as the condensing medium. The condenser’s sump pumps the water to be sprayed over coils and simultaneously, a fan blows the air into the condenser.

How is water divided in a single pass condenser?

In single pass condenser, the water flows in one direction only whereas in double pass, the water flows in one direction through the tube and returns through the remainder tubes, as shown in Fig. 4.20.
